Starmer’s Trump Win Fails to Calm UK Labour Worries About Farage

May 10, 2025, 5:00 AM UTC

Keir Starmer’s double victory in securing trade deals with India and the US this week still isn’t enough to pacify restive lawmakers in the UK’s governing Labour Party.

Last week, the British premier faced a breakdown in party discipline after hemorrhaging seats in local elections dominated by the insurgent populist Nigel Farage’s Reform UK party. Starmer responded with two of his best days in office, sealing a free trade deal with India on Tuesday followed by a pact with President Donald Trump on Thursday that cut US tariffs on cars and steel.
